*
*


CAPTCHA Image   Reload Image
X

CASE-технологии. Современные методы и средства проектирования информационных систем

рефераты, информационные технологии

Объем работы: 52 стр

Год сдачи: 2009

Стоимость: 400 руб.

Просмотров: 1118

 

Не подходит работа?
Узнай цену на написание.

Оглавление
Введение
Заключение
Заказать работу
Содержание
1. Введение…………………………………………………………………………………………….3
2. Основы методологии проектирования ИС……………………………………………………….6
2.1. Жизненный цикл по ИС……………………………………………………………………….6
2.2. Модели жизненного цикла ПО……………………………………………………………….7
2.3. Методологии и технологии проектирования ИС……………………………………………9
2.3.1. Общие требования к методологии и технологии…………………………………...9
2.3.2. Методология RAD……………………………………………………………………11
3. Структурный подход к проектированию ИС…………………………………………………....14
3.1. Сущность структурного подхода………………………………………………………….....14
3.2. Методология функционального моделирования SADT…………………………………….15
3.2.1. Состав функциональной модели…………………………………………………...15
3.2.2. Иерархия диаграмм…………………………………………………………………..16
3.2.3. Типы связей между функциями…………………………………………………….20
3.3. Моделирование потоков данных (процессов)……………………………………………….22
3.3.1. Внешние сущности…………………………………………………………………..23
3.3.2. Системы и подсистемы………………………………………………………………………..23
3.3.3. Процессы……………………………………………………………………………...23
3.3.4. Накопители данных…………………………………………………………………..24
3.3.5. Потоки данных………………………………………………………………………..24
3.3.6. Построение иерархии диаграмм потоков данных………………………………...24
3.4. Моделирование данных……………………………………………………………………….26
3.4.1. Case-метод Баркера…………………………………………………………………..26
3.4.2. Методология IDEF1…………………………………………………………………..30
4. Характеристики CASE-средств……………………………………………………………….......33
4.1. Silverrun+JAM…………………………………………………………………………………..33
4.1.1. Silverrun………………………………………………………………………………..33
4.1.2. JAM…………………………………………………………………………………….35
4.2. Vantage Team Builder (Westmount I-CASE) + Uniface………………………………………..38
4.2.1. Vantage Team Builder (Westmount I-CASE)………………………………………….38
4.2.2. Uniface………………………………………………………………………………….41
4.3. Designer/2000 + Developer/2000……………………………………………………………..…42
4.4. Локальные средства (ERwin, BPwin, S-Designor, CASE.Аналитик)………………………..44
4.5. Объектно-ориентированные CASE-средства (Rational Rose)……………………………….45
4.6....
Введение

Целью данного обзора является введение в особенности современных методов и средств проектирования информационных систем, основанных на использовании CASE-технологии.
Несмотря на высокие потенциальные возможности CASE-технологии (увеличение производительности труда, улучшение качества программных продуктов, поддержка унифицированного и согласованного стиля работы) далеко не все разработчики информационных систем, использующие CASE-средства, достигают ожидаемых результатов.
Существуют различные причины возможных неудач, но, видимо, основной причиной является неадекватное понимание сути программирования информационных систем и применения CASE-средств. Необходимо понимать, что процесс проектирования и разработки информационной системы на основе CASE-технологии не может быть подобен процессу приготовления пищи по поваренной книге. Всегда следует быть готовым к новым трудностям, связанным с освоением новой технологии, последовательно преодолевать эти трудности и последовательно добиваться нужных результатов.
Тенденции развития современных информационных технологий приводят к постоянному возрастанию сложности информационных систем (ИС), создаваемых в различных областях экономики. Современные крупные проекты ИС характеризуются, как правило, следующими особенностями:
• сложность описания (достаточно большое количество функций, процессов, элементов данных и сложные взаимосвязи между ними), требующая тщательного моделирования и анализа данных и процессов;
• наличие совокупности тесно взаимодействующих компонентов (подсистем), имеющих свои локальные задачи и цели функционирования (например, традиционных приложений, связанных с обработкой транзакций и решением регламентных задач, и приложений аналитической обработки (поддержки принятия решений), использующих нерегламентированные запросы к данным большого объема);
• отсутствие прямых аналогов, ограничивающее возможность использования каких-либо типовых проектных решений и прикладных систем;
• необходимость...
В заключение приведем примеры комплексов CASE-средств обеспечивающих поддержку полного ЖЦ ПО. Здесь хотелось бы еще раз отметить нецелесообразность сравнения отдельно взятых CASE-средств, поскольку ни одно из них не решает в целом все проблемы создания и сопровождения ПО. Это подтверждается также полным набором критериев оценки и выбора, которые затрагивают все этапы ЖЦ ПО. Сравниваться могут комплексы методологически и технологически согласованных инструментальных средств, поддерживающие полный ЖЦ ПО и обеспеченные необходимой технической и методической поддержкой со стороны фирм-поставщиков. По мнению автора, на сегодняшний день наиболее развитым из всех поставляемых в России комплексов такого рода является комплекс технологий и инструментальных средств создания ИС, основанный на методологии и технологии DATARUN. В состав комплекса входят следующие инструментальные средства:
• CASE-средство Silverrun;
• средство разработки приложений JAM;
• мост Silverrun-RDM <-> JAM;
• комплекс средств тестирования QA;
• менеджер транзакций Tuxedo;
• комплекс средств планирования и управления проектом SE Companion;
• комплекс средств конфигурационного управления PVCS;
• объектно-ориентированное CASE-средство Rational Rose;
• средство документирования SoDA.
Примерами других подобных комплексов являются:
• Vantage Team Builder for Uniface + Uniface (фирмы \"DataX/Florin\" и \"ЛАНИТ\");
• комплекс средств, поставляемых и используемых фирмой \"ФОРС\":
• CASE-средства Designer/2000 (основное), ERwin, Bpwin и Oowin (альтернативные);
• средства разработки приложений Developer/2000, ORACLE Power Objects (основные) и Usoft Developer (альтернативное).

После офорления заказа Вам будут доступны содержание, введение, список литературы*
*- если автор дал согласие и выложил это описание.

Работу высылаем в течении суток после поступления денег на счет
ФИО*


E-mail для получения работы *


Телефон


ICQ


Дополнительная информация, вопросы, комментарии:



CAPTCHA Image
Сусловиямиприбретения работы согласен.

 
Добавить страницу в закладки
Отправить ссылку другу